About the Organization St. Vincent Catholic Charities (STVCC) is a non-profit, human services agency dedicated to serving the most vulnerable. Every year, thousands of lives are transformed through the agency's programs which include foster care, adoption, mental health counseling, refugee services, and an Immigration Law Clinic. Located in Michigan's capital and with more than 70+ years of compassionate service to the community, STVCC is proud to have forged relationships with community partners of almost every creed. STVCC's work is carried out by employees (and interns/volunteers) and we welcome those passionate about serving others to join us on this journey of providing help and hope.

Job Summary

Provide support to two immigration attorneys in immigration-related legal representation for Afghan nationals, with a focus on asylum and SIV.

Role and Responsibilities

  • Conduct legal and country conditions research.
  • Organize documents related to ongoing and closed cases.
  • Meet with clients to gather information.
  • Draft legal documents such as affidavits and immigration forms.
  • Develop and maintain knowledge base of immigration related laws, regulations and pending legislation.
  • Attend and participate in agency meetings, as appropriate.
  • Work collaboratively with volunteers and interns.
  • Advocate for immigrant rights through positive relations with other CBOs and government entities.

Position Requirements

Qualifications and Education Requirements

Education: Certification or Associate’s Degree in Paralegal Studies. B.A. preferred.

 

Experience: 6 months of paralegal experience; exposure to US asylum law; experience as part of a multicultural team.

 

Registration, licenses, certifications or special training: MI operator license; computer skills; excellent written and oral communications skills; second language (Urdu, Dari, Pashto) preferred.
